✨ About The Role
- The Principal Software Engineer will collaborate with product managers, designers, and other engineers to shape the product roadmap and implement features.
- This role involves driving innovation by exploring and integrating AI-driven solutions into Titan's products.
- The engineer will contribute to the development and enhancement of the award-winning mobile app built with React Native.
- Responsibilities include optimizing backend systems that handle millions of dollars in daily transactions using Node.js.
- The role requires working with MongoDB databases to ensure performance, scalability, and security.
- The engineer will take ownership of projects across the stack, ensuring efficient, secure, and high-quality delivery.
⚡ Requirements
- The ideal candidate will have over 6 years of hands-on experience in building scalable, high-performance applications using JavaScript and TypeScript.
- A proven track record of designing, building, and delivering innovative products that drive meaningful outcomes is essential.
- Strong problem-solving and collaboration skills are necessary, especially in dynamic and fast-paced environments.
- The candidate should possess a strong sense of responsibility and integrity, acting in the best interests of clients.
- A relentless growth mindset with a passion for continuous improvement and excellence is highly valued.
- Leadership experience is a plus, but technical expertise and a drive to deliver impact are the primary focus.